I had two friends with these motors with the exact problem, turned out to be the impeller inside the water pump was not keeping up with satisfactory pressure and it would kick the alarm. Im not talking about your sea water rubber impeller, talking about the engine block mounted water pump. The gauges all read fine chased this problem for a month until they found it and both were fixed.
